A Comprehensive Study Report on Cannabidiol (CBD)

Cannabidiol (CBD) has emerged as a prominent compound in the cannabis plant, garnering significant attention for CBD oil extract its potential therapeutic benefits and diverse applications. This report delves into the multifaceted aspects of CBD, encompassing its chemical properties, pharmacological effects, potential therapeutic uses, legal status, and safety considerations.

Chemical Properties and Origins:

CBD is a non-psychoactive cannabinoid, meaning it does not induce the "high" associated with tetrahydrocannabinol (THC). It is structurally similar to THC but lacks the psychoactive properties. CBD is found abundantly in the cannabis plant, particularly in hemp varieties with low THC content. Extraction methods, such as supercritical CO2 extraction, are commonly employed to isolate CBD from the plant material.

Legal Status:

The legal status of CBD varies widely depending on the country and jurisdiction. In the United States, CBD derived from hemp with less than 0.3% THC is legal at the federal level. However, CBD derived from marijuana remains illegal in many states.

Safety Considerations:

CBD is generally considered safe for human consumption. However, potential side effects may include drowsiness, dry mouth, diarrhea, and changes in appetite. It is important to consult with a healthcare professional before using CBD, especially if you are pregnant, breastfeeding, or taking medications.
